Summary

Operator feedback after #117: the corner-light gradients on data cards (the `.glass-panel` / `.glass-panel-strong` class) read too vibrant once the pattern was applied broadly to deck cards, stat cards, list cards, modals, dropdowns, etc.

The same intensity works fine on the floating chrome chips (sidebar nav, top header) — there are only two of those per viewport and they should anchor the page as the surfaces "responding" to the background light sources. Data cards tile densely; at full intensity they compete with the chrome and the catch-lights read as noise rather than environmental cue.

This PR splits the tokens into two intensity tiers, keeping the chrome at full intensity and pulling data cards down to ~55%.

Token tiers

Token Light theme Dark theme Surface
`--corner-light-warm` 0.50 0.68 Chrome (full intensity)
`--corner-light-cool` 0.38 0.58 Chrome (full intensity)
`--corner-light-warm-subtle` 0.28 0.38 Data cards (NEW)
`--corner-light-cool-subtle` 0.20 0.32 Data cards (NEW)

`.glass-panel` and `.glass-panel-strong` now consume the `-subtle` variants. Inline `boxShadow` in `components/Layout.js` and `components/ui/TopSearchBar.js` keep referencing the original tokens — no chrome regressions.

No token names removed; any future component that wants the full-intensity chrome treatment can opt in via `--corner-light-{warm,cool}`.
